Osun Gov Election Tribunal commences sitting on Oyetola’s petition, adjourns to Oct 4

The Osun State Election Petition Tribunal commenced sitting on the petition of Governor Gboyega Oyetola of the All Progressives Congress (APC) challenging the victory of Ademola Adeleke of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) in the recent governorship election in the state.

The tribunal granting the request of the INEC, PDP and Adeleke for 7-days to respond to the pre-hearing form served on them by the tribunal, adjourned sitting to Tuesday, October 4 for a proper commencement of pre-hearing.

Counsel to the APC, Professor Kayode Olatoke (SAN), at the sitting of the tribunal, notified the court of his readiness to continue with pre-hearing session, having filed his form TF008, where issues for determination were raised.

Counsel to the INEC, Ben Ananaba (SAN) told the court that the pre-hearing could not proceed because he was just served with the pre-hearing form this morning, noting that statutorily, they have seven day to respond.

Counsel to Adeleke, Bamidele Abolarin and counsel representing PDP, Nathaniel Oke (SAN), joined in requesting for the required seven days to respond from the tribunal.

Chairman of the tribunal, Justice Teresa Kume, thereafter, adjourned sitting to Tuesday, October 4 for the commencement of hearing properly.
